Spray Drying Method for Taste Masking Applications

*Background
Many drugs are bitter and overcoming this bittertaste is a major barrier in developing a successful product for pediatricpatients. Compliance rates as low as11% have been reported in children due to palatability/taste as well asswallowability, and dose flexibility issues. As a result, there existsan unmet need for palatable formulations for drugs delivered orally.Various strategieshave been applied to pharmaceutical products to try to improve taste andpalatability. Historically, sweeteners and flavors have been used to altertaste perception. More effective approaches to taste masking involve completelyisolating the offensive drug from taste buds in the mouth, either by coatingtablets or filling the drug into capsules. Unfortunately, these approaches arenot useful for pediatric patients, as swallowing the product can be an issue. Otherapproaches for taste masking include modifying drug solubility through complexationwith ion exchange resins or cyclodextrins. The success of these approaches,however, is highly dependent on the chemical properties of the drug and thusare not applicable to a wide range of drugs. Moreover, these approaches couldpotentially alter drug dissolution and subsequently absorption followingingestion.
